Venturing into the realm of medication can feel challenging, especially when faced with the selection between prescription and over-the-counter options. While both serve to address a variety of ailments, their availability and regulatory requirements differ significantly. Prescription medications, requiring a doctor's endorsement, often target severe conditions and may involve potential consequences. On the other hand, over-the-counter medications are readily obtainable without a physician's input, typically treating common ailments. Understanding these key distinctions is crucial for making informed selections about your health and well-being.
Pharmacy's Nuances
Compounding pharmacies stand as a specialized bridge between the age-old practices of pharmacy and the advanced demands of patient care. These pharmacies specialize in creating customized medications, tailored to address individual patient needs. This intricate process requires a fusion of artistic skill and scientific exactness, ensuring the potency and well-being of each compounded medication.
- Compounding Specialists in these pharmacies harness their expertise to prepare medications from raw ingredients, modifying dosages and formulations to cater patients with specific needs.
- Instances of compounding include manufacturing transdermal patches for localized delivery, preparing liquid medications for children or resistant patients, and designing sterile preparations for intravenous administration.
Furthermore, compounding pharmacies often work closely with physicians to create individualized treatment plans that enhance patient outcomes. This collaborative approach emphasizes the crucial role of compounding pharmacies in providing personalized and effective healthcare solutions.

Grasping Drug Formulations: From API to Finished Product
The journey of a drug from its fundamental active pharmaceutical ingredient (API) to the final consumer product involves numerous intricate steps. First, the active API is carefully selected and synthesized. This compound forms the basis of the medication's therapeutic effect. Subsequently, it undergoes a meticulous process of manufacturing, where it is combined with supporting ingredients to create various dosage forms like tablets, capsules, or solutions. These excipients play crucial roles in ensuring stability and enhancing the drug's bioavailability.
Throughout this evolutionary process, stringent quality control measures are ensured at each stage to guarantee the safety, efficacy, and consistency of the final product.
- The choice of excipients is crucial for ensuring optimal drug delivery and patient compliance.
- Modern formulation techniques often involve advanced technologies like nanotechnology to improve drug solubility and target specific tissues.
- Understanding the intricate interplay between API and excipients allows scientists to optimize drug formulations for maximum therapeutic benefit and minimal side effects.

Unlocking Tailored Treatment: The Benefits of Compounding Pharmacies
Compounding pharmacies offer a distinct advantage for patients seeking customized treatment options. These pharmacies have the ability to blend medications precisely according to a physician's requirements, ensuring maximum therapeutic outcomes. For individuals with specific needs, such as allergies or sensitivities to conventional ingredients, compounding pharmacies can provide effective alternatives.
The flexibility of compounding allows for the development of medications in various formats, including liquids, creams, gels, and suppositories, making it easier to give medications to patients who may have difficulty swallowing pills or experiencing discomfort with other delivery methods. By employing high-quality ingredients and strict observance to quality control measures, compounding pharmacies ensure the safety of their formulations.
